Monolithic Power Systems Past Earnings Performance

Monolithic Power Systems has been growing earnings at an average annual rate of 28.6%, while the Semiconductor industry saw earnings growing at 20.7% annually. Revenues have been growing at an average rate of 24.1% per year. Monolithic Power Systems''s return on equity is 18.5%, and it has net margins of 21.3%.

Monolithic Power Systems, Inc. (MPWR)

In 2023, Monolithic Power Systems''s revenue was $1.82 billion, an increase of 1.50% compared to the previous year''s $1.79 billion. Earnings were $427.37 million, a decrease of -2.35%. Monolithic Power Systems Inc (MPWR) Reports Q3 2023

Monolithic Power Systems Inc (NASDAQ:MPWR) reported a Q3 2023 revenue of $474.9 million, a 7.6% increase from Q2 2023 but a 4.1% decrease YoY. GAAP gross margin was 55.5%, down from 58.7% in Q3 2022.

Monolithic Power Systems Net Income 2010-2024 | MPWR

Monolithic Power Systems net income for the quarter ending June 30, 2024 was $0.100B, a 0.87% increase year-over-year. Monolithic Power Systems net income for the twelve months ending June 30, 2024 was $0.411B, a 9.22% decline year-over-year. Monolithic Power Systems annual net income for 2023 was $0.427B, a 2.35% decline from 2022

How did monolithic power systems perform in Q3 2023?

Monolithic Power Systems Inc ( NASDAQ:MPWR) reported a $474.9 million revenue in Q3 2023, which represents a 7.6% increase from Q2 2023. However, this is a 4.1% decrease YoY. The GAAP gross margin was 55.5%, down from 58.7% in Q3 2022. The GAAP operating income stood at $135.6 million, compared to $151.9 million in the same period last year.
